Tīwhiri 2 Pānui programme Online Organisation (Microsoft 365)
This post is for pouako/kaiako that utilise Microsoft Teams and are fortunate enough to have a class/group set of devices.
This online' version of a Pānui Rotational Plan can be implemented successfully in years 5 up.
Hua/Benefits: Pouako/Kaiako
- minimal preparation
- time efficiency
- energy efficiency
- no limitation re number of readers/pukapuka available
Hua/Benefits: Tamariki
- encourages self directed learning
- supports tamariki to work at their own pace
- builds foundational skills towards NCEA (online instructions-comprehension)
Whakaritenga:
- Create a Team-Pānui
- Within the Pānui Team create one channel for each of your Pānui Rōpū-choose an avatar/image
- Select a Pānui rōpū and post an announcement outlining the day's tasks
- Upload a link to the digital book in Kauwhata Reo e.g. He aha ahau? KKa (select the image below for reference)
- If you have time-record yourself or a colleague reading the book(easy using Iphone Voice memos)-upload link
- Upload Ngohe/Activity e.g. Kimi Hā Resources-Kupu Noho Nanu shown below
- Repeat for each Pānui Rōpū/Channel
Final Product looks like this: (Kura will have Teams instead of Communities):
The beauty of this online organisation is the minimal effort required to set Pānui tasks daily. At a glance you can see each Pānui Rōpū focus book and the tasks set which enables you to monitor clearly each rōpū and their progress.
Once you get the hang of it, your planning time for each day is reduced to 30 minutes maximum to set up each rōpū daily task for the next day.
